The approach is centred on the ISO 12913-2:2018 Technical Standard which proposes a standardised method for soundscape data collection that includes 3D sound recordings, measurements of acoustic and psychoacoustic parameters and provides example questionnaires for subjective perception. While ISO 12913-2 describes procedures for how recordings, measurements, and interviews are to be carried out, much of the Standard is informative only. A structured format has specifically been developed to further standardise an approach and understand how it may be implemented effectively within a corporate acoustic consulting environment. This study discusses findings and conclusions gathered from undertaking soundscape surveys using the structured approach at seven purposely selected urban centres across the world. Further development has been made on how to interpret and implement the ISO 12913-2 Standard to facilitate and make accessible for use within the corporate consulting environment. Conclusions have been drawn from the issues faced and recommendations for further consideration provided that are based on correlations in the data set obtained through the surveys.", }
